当前位置:网站首页>“如何实现集中管理、灵活高效的CI/CD”在线研讨会精彩内容分享
“如何实现集中管理、灵活高效的CI/CD”在线研讨会精彩内容分享
2022-04-23 03:11:00 【龙智—DevOps解决方案】
“如何实现集中管理、灵活高效的CI/CD”在线研讨会精彩片段分享
片段主讲人:李培(西瓜刀)

大家好,我是李培。前面听文老师讲DevOps,包括CI/CD 的一些理论,也是挺有收获。我想结合我的不管是开发还是技术支持的实际工作经验中,遇到了一些思考,来给大家分享一下。前面听文老师已经讲过,现在DevOps,包括DevSecOps,除了传统的研发和运营之间的鸿沟需要进行弥补以外,安全问题——刚才文老师讲的流程里边,需要可以做测试,然后可以把包括软件成分分析,包括软件静态扫描工具,都可以集成到整个流程中,能加速产品的有效交付。DevOps现在虽然很热,但是实际上十年前,还没有这个概念的时候,研发团队面对市场的实际问题时,也会自发的做一些类似的工作。首先,从逻辑上来讲,它有利于弥补传统的研发运营、分离造成的割裂。一般来说,比较大的公司里会有部门讲,研发人员实际上是不会太关心运营人员的死活。坦白来说,如果是有一个bug报给研发人员,如果是没有一些流程的约束或者管理的话,那可能自然反应就是说:来我帮你改一下、我提交一下、你去测吧,基本就是这个思路。运营的话,是希望求稳。因为一旦线上的东西出问题,不管是电信机房里面的设备,还是刚才文老师提到的比如一些金融的外部应用,往往代表很多人夜不能寐,可能半夜两点被叫起来去解决问题。所以说,二者身上是存在鸿沟的。不光是研发和运营,甚至还有测试,每个部门实际上所关注的点都有所区别的。测试就希望最安全,永远发现有问题,永远不要发布,那这样的话就没有风险。但研发部门就希望东西能发出去,这样头上的任务就交差了。然后运维部分,运维部门就希望有一个稳定的版本,非必要不随便升级,每个人他都有自己的关注点。以前没有提到DevOps的时候,比如十年前,我当时工作的那家公司接到一个很重要的项目,一战定生死的这种项目,不计成本。研发是说我都做好了,可以交付了,但是运营是不敢接的,就说这个搞不了,失败不起承担不起。那怎么办?上面大老板就会拍板。最后,我们去香港,找一个大酒店包两层楼包了两年。研发人员不管是大牛小牛,都是驻场,就住在那里,有什么问题就当天给家里反馈。修改了之后,马上把版本发出去。这实际上是一种,没有完善的工具流程支撑,但就是肉体和精神层面的DevOps…
除了 龙智技术支持负责人 李培外,还有 CloudBees亚太区资深解决方案工程师 杨海涛与清晖项目管理资深讲师、EXIN DOF授权认证讲师 文吉 等大咖坐镇此次研讨会,分享他们在DevOps、CI/CD等领域的经验与心得。
我们将会议进行了全程录制, 方便您在任何时间观看,不错过任何精彩内容。点击获取完整版视频。


版权声明
本文为[龙智—DevOps解决方案]所创,转载请带上原文链接,感谢
https://blog.csdn.net/weixin_49715102/article/details/124311079
边栏推荐
- Due to 3 ²+ four ²= five ², Therefore, we call '3,4,5' as the number of Pythagorean shares, and find the array of all Pythagorean shares within n (including n).
- . net core current limiting control - aspnetcoreratelimit
- 基于.NetCore开发博客项目 StarBlog - (1) 为什么需要自己写一个博客?
- [untitled]
- The most easy to understand dependency injection and control inversion
- Array and collection types passed by openfeign parameters
- 2022年度Top9的任务管理系统
- 最通俗易懂的依赖注入与控制反转
- ASP. Net 6 middleware series - execution sequence
- 全网最全,接口自动化测试怎么做的?精通接口自动化测试详解
猜你喜欢

最通俗易懂的依赖注入与控制反转

LNMP MySQL allows remote access
![[MySQL] left function | right function](/img/26/82e0f2280de011636c26931a74e749.png)
[MySQL] left function | right function

Impact of AOT and single file release on program performance

由于3²+4²=5²,所以称‘3,4,5‘为勾股数,求n(包括n)以内所有勾股数数组。

类似Jira的十大项目管理软件

准备一个月去参加ACM,是一种什么体验?

Tencent video price rise: earn more than 7.4 billion a year! Pay attention to me to receive Tencent VIP members, and the weekly card is as low as 7 yuan

全网最全,接口自动化测试怎么做的?精通接口自动化测试详解

C#中切片语法糖的使用
随机推荐
Using stack to solve the problem of "mini parser"
TP5 email (2020-05-27)
数据挖掘系列(3)_Excel的数据挖掘插件_估计分析
队列的存储和循环队列
[authentication / authorization] customize an authentication handler
Queue storage and circular queue
MAUI初体验:爽
由于3²+4²=5²,所以称‘3,4,5‘为勾股数,求n(包括n)以内所有勾股数数组。
MYSQL04_ Exercises corresponding to arithmetic, logic, bit, operator and operator
《C语言程序设计》(谭浩强第五版) 第9章 用户自己建立数据类型 习题解析与答案
微软是如何解决 PC 端程序多开问题的——内部实现
ASP. Net 6 middleware series - execution sequence
Ningde's position in the times is not guaranteed?
Creating wechat voucher process with PHP
Using positive and negative traversal to solve the problem of "the shortest distance of characters"
[MySQL] left Function | Right Function
Openfeign timeout setting
Passing object type parameters through openfeign
编码电机PID调试(速度环|位置环|跟随)
最通俗易懂的依赖注入之服务容器与作用域